In this episode of "Defrost the Chicken," host Natalie Calderon and guest Paula explore the vital topic of creating open lines of communication with children. Paula shares her personal experiences and challenges as a single mother raising her 19-year-old son. She emphasizes the importance of building trust and fostering an environment where children feel comfortable discussing sensitive topics. The conversation highlights the complexities of modern parenting, from handling teenage relationships to balancing discipline and support.
The episode delves into Paula's journey of raising her son alone, the effects of maintaining a close mother-son relationship, and the lessons learned from past parenting decisions. Paula opens up about a significant incident involving her son and the measures taken to address it, underscoring the value of trust and understanding between parent and child. Through heartfelt anecdotes and candid discussions, this episode provides valuable insights for parents striving to create a safe space for their children.

Join host Natalie Calderon in this episode of 'Defrost the Chicken' as she sits down with Diane to explore the intricate journey of motherhood. Together, they delve into the often unspoken challenges of losing one's identity as a mother. With candid conversations and personal anecdotes, Natalie and Diane shed light on the emotional transitions women face, from balancing friendships and marriage to managing expectations within traditional upbringings.
Through their engaging discussion, they highlight the importance of maintaining individuality and the struggle to prioritize self-care amidst the demands of everyday life. This episode offers comfort and camaraderie to mothers who feel overwhelmed yet determined to find themselves again.
